
Smoked Mackerel & Potato Bake
This warming, thrifty family supper takes just ten minutes to prepare.
Serves: 4 people
Prep: 10 mins
Cooking: 25 mins
Total Time: 35 mins
Ingredients
700g potato, cut into 3cm cubes
1 small onion, thinly sliced
25g butter
200g smoked mackerel
2 tbsp chopped dill
150ml double cream
100ml fish stock
2 tbsp creamed horseradish
Method
Heat oven to 200C/180C fan/gas 6.
Cook the potatoes and onion in boiling, salted water for 6-7 mins until almost tender. Drain well.
Grease a 20 x 20cm baking dish with a little of the butter, then arrange the potatoes in it.
Break the fish into chunky pieces, discarding any skin and bones. Tuck the pieces in and around the potatoes, then scatter over the dill.
Whisk the cream, stock and horseradish together and season. Pour over the potatoes.
Dot the remaining butter over the top, then bake for 20-25 mins until golden.
Serve with a green salad, if you like.
